
Westminster Small Sites
Westminster
Carter Jonas advised Westminster City Council on the redevelopment of two council-owned garage sites in Ladbroke Grove. The council wished to redevelop the sites to address the urgent need for social housing in the borough.
Our planning team were involved with the pre-application discussions with the council and led the project team through the planning process advising on challenging issues such as loss of parking and proximity, visual impact and daylight, and sunlight impacts on adjacent existing residential properties. The team advised and attended public engagement events with local residents and ward councilors.
Our professionals prepared and submitted two planning applications for two and seven homes respectively. Three-bedroom homes of social rent tenure were proposed to address the acute need for affordable family housing. Both applications proposed improvements to the public realm to ensure something was given back to existing residents.
The two-unit scheme was granted planning permission by delegated powers and the seven-unit scheme was granted planning permission at planning committee, where our experts spoke on behalf of the applicant.
